Transaction 24bfe437fd4d5d903ed29a4ca5f8b35fee5a7cd8a11427ae1f1e45326d01ba2e
1 Input
1 Output
-
24bfe437fd4d5d903ed29a4ca5f8b35fee5a7cd8a11427ae1f1e45326d01ba2e:0
- value
- 18363801
- script pubkey
- OP_0 OP_PUSHBYTES_20 1f21f4bc00b7db701fa548a9bc77cd378c710caa
- address
- bc1qruslf0qqkldhq8a9fz5mca7dx7x8zr92qau6rc